What I learned from this experience is that control arm bushings are one of those critical components that most drivers never think about – until they fail. They're the silent guardians of your vehicle's handling and safety, working tirelessly to maintain the connection between your suspension and chassis.
The factory rubber bushings in most vehicles are designed to be cost-effective rather than long-lasting or high-performance. They soften over time, crack under stress, and ultimately compromise your vehicle's stability and safety. This isn't just about comfort – it's about maintaining the precise handling characteristics that your vehicle's engineers designed.
